Iceland Trip 2005
Here's a selection of photos from my trip to Iceland in 2005. While the weather was forecast to be clear skies and a little of the chilly side, the plane landed in a blizzard and everything as far as they eye could see was covered in snow. My camera batteries died on a couple of occassions because of the cold and some of the locations I visited were so cold, my hands were shaking so much that I couldn't hold the camera steady.
